Installation Procedure

WARNING: This page is about a different car, the 2017 Chevrolet Spark. However, it is still accessible from the selected car via links, so may be relevant.
  1. Check which one of crankshaft front oil seals (1, 2) is installed.
    Fig 1: Identifying Crankshaft Front Oil Seal
    GM3686999Courtesy of GENERAL MOTORS COMPANY
    NOTE: The engine can be equipped with two different front oil seal designs.
  2. For front oil seal first design, use the following procedure:
    Fig 2: Installing Crankshaft Front Oil Seal
    GM3686995Courtesy of GENERAL MOTORS COMPANY
  3. Install the crankshaft front oil seal (1) to the EN-51368  seal installer (2) with the notch on the surface (3).
    NOTE: The special tool EN-51368  seal installer can be used in two positions, depending which crankshaft front oil seal type is used.
  4. For front oil seal second design, use the following procedure:
    Fig 3: Front Oil Seal Second Design Procedure
    GM3686997Courtesy of GENERAL MOTORS COMPANY
  5. Install the crankshaft front oil seal (1) to the EN-51368  seal installer (2) with the plane surface (3).
    NOTE: The special tool EN-51368  seal installer can be used in two positions, depending which crankshaft front oil seal type is used.
  6. Press the crankshaft front oil seal into the correct seat, by tightening the nut (2) from the EN-51368  seal installer (1).
    Fig 4: Installing Crankshaft Front Oil Seal
    GM3686994Courtesy of GENERAL MOTORS COMPANY
    CAUTION: Be careful that the crankshaft front oil seal does not deform while installing. Failing to do so may reduce the leak-tightness and could cause damage to the crankshaft.
  7. Remove the EN-51368  seal installer.
  8. Check the correct seat of the crankshaft front oil seal.
  9. Install the crankshaft balancer. Refer to Crankshaft Balancer Replacement (L5Q) .
